Product Introduction

Overview

The MC100EP11DTG is a 3.3 V/5 V ECL (Emitter-Coupled Logic) 1:2 differential fanout buffer produced by onsemi. This device is part of the 100 Series, which includes temperature compensation, making it ideal for applications requiring high-speed AC performance. The MC100EP11DTG is pin and functionally equivalent to the LVEL11 device but offers significantly faster AC performance. It operates in both PECL (Positive ECL) and NECL (Negative ECL) modes, supporting a wide range of voltage supplies.

Key Features

  • High-Speed Performance: Typical propagation delay of 220 ps and maximum clock frequency greater than 3 GHz.
  • Dual Voltage Operation: Supports both PECL and NECL modes with a wide range of voltage supplies (VCC = 3.0 V to 5.5 V, VEE = -3.0 V to -5.5 V).
  • Temperature Compensation: Included in the 100 Series, ensuring stable performance across temperature variations.
  • Input Protection: Features internal input pulldown and pullup resistors, as well as ESD protection (Human Body Model > 4 kV, Machine Model > 200 V, Charged Device Model > 2 kV).
  • Default State: Outputs default to LOW when inputs are open or at VEE.
  • Environmental Compliance: Pb-Free, Halogen-Free, and RoHS compliant.

Applications

The MC100EP11DTG is suitable for high-speed digital systems that require fast signal propagation and low jitter. Typical applications include:

  • High-Speed Data Transmission Systems: Ideal for applications requiring rapid data transfer, such as in telecommunications and networking equipment.
  • High-Frequency Clock Distribution: Used in systems that need to distribute high-frequency clock signals with minimal skew and jitter.
  • Test and Measurement Equipment: Utilized in high-speed test and measurement instruments where precise timing is critical.
  • High-Performance Computing: Suitable for use in high-performance computing environments where fast signal propagation is essential.
